Chairman Miles Pelham Sells $7.2M Stake; Cancels Warrants for 40M Shares in Resulticks Deal

Chairman Miles Pelham sold $7.2M of Diginex shares at $1.00 each, cutting his stake to 40.5%. He also agreed to cancel warrants and equity awards for 40M new shares tied to the Resulticks acquisition.


Key Events · Ownership and Investor Activity · DGNX

  • Chairman Sells $7.2M Stake

    On August 17, 2026, Miles Pelham sold 294,380 shares and Rhino Cayman sold 6,908,540 shares, all at $1.00 per share, totaling $7,202,920.

  • Warrants Cancelled for 40M Shares

    Pelham and Rhino Cayman agreed to terminate the 51% Warrant, IPO Warrants, RSUs, and PSUs in exchange for 40 million new Ordinary Shares at the closing of the Resulticks acquisition.

  • Ownership Drops to 40.5%

    After the sales, Pelham beneficially owns 33,351,473 shares (40.5%) and Rhino Cayman owns 33,048,073 shares (40.1%), based on 82,446,496 shares outstanding including warrants.

  • Resulticks Deal Terms

    The amended acquisition values Resulticks at $1.05 billion, payable in 600 million new shares at $1.75 per share, expected to close by October 30, 2026.

A significant insider transaction has just been disclosed. On August 17, 2026, Diginex's chairman and controlling shareholder, Miles Pelham, sold $7.2 million worth of shares at $1.00 each, reducing his stake to 40.5%. The sale comes just days after the company amended its Resulticks acquisition to $1.05 billion in stock. In a related move, Pelham and his investment vehicle Rhino Cayman agreed to cancel all outstanding warrants, RSUs, and PSUs in exchange for 40 million new shares at the deal's closing. This restructuring of insider holdings and the large sale signal a shift in the company's control structure ahead of the transformative acquisition.
